Had a lovely day today. Got all packed, got up at 6am to finish the last of the tidying up in the flat, said goodbye to my gorgeous flatmates, and got the bus from Salamanca early for my Ryanair flight (of which there is only 1 a day).

Got myself a bocadillo, some coke, bought my newspaper and settled myself in the warmth of this tiny airport, smug at the fact I was 2 hours early and all sorted, and that I had a perfect seat with which to watch any eye-catching female passengers through the window who'd come from from the arrivals lounge next door.

Being the normally organized person I usually am, I then totally surprised myself at Valladolid airport at security when I realized (somewhat too late) that I hadn't my passport on me. Pockets? no. In my bag? no. Under my wardrobe hidden from burglars back in Salamanca? ...yes.

So after spending close to 50€ on taxis, bus fares, and another bottle of coke, I'm back here, writing this. I still can't believe I did the classic, as I back myself as very well travelled... maybe, as I was the packing, the bottle of champagne I had to myself the night before was an error of judgement. :oops: :oops:
